On Stochastic Properties Of The Condition Standby System

Redundant system is main object of reliability mathematics.Warm standby system,cold standby system,hot system and load-sharing parallel system are all typical redundant systems.They have been widely used in many fields.This paper includes three parts.In the first part,we mainly study the stochastic comparisons of a general standby system with one standby component and two active units.It is concluded that the performance of the load-sharing parallel system is better than the warm standby system,the performance of the cold standby system is better than the warm standby system,and the performance of the cold standby system is better than the hot system in the sense of certain stochastic order.In the second part,we investigate the optimal allocation of standby to a general standby system.Firstly,we discussed the optimal allocation problem of a single standby component in a series system of two or three separate components.It is possible to improve the performance of the system by assigning the warm standby component to a working component with larger hazard rate order or reversed hazard rate order.Secondly,we investigate the optimal allocation problem of one of two general standby in a series system one with two independent components.Finally,we investigate the optimal allocation of a single standby in a parallel system with two independent components.In the sense of stochastic precedence order,a warm standby is distributed to the stronger active unit of the parallel system is proven to be better than the warm standby is distributed to the weaker active unit.In the third part,we investigate the stochastic comparison between a system of used components and a used system in the series system or parallel system.Cases of residual life and inactivity time are investigated,respectively.
